Overview
Ben Lippen School is a private, college-preparatory Christian school located in Columbia, South Carolina, serving students from pre-kindergarten through grade 12. Established with a commitment to integrating rigorous academics with strong spiritual development, the school fosters an environment where students can grow intellectually, emotionally, and morally. Ben Lippen emphasizes academic excellence while nurturing Christian values, encouraging students to engage in service, leadership, and character development alongside their studies. The school provides a robust curriculum that prepares students for college and future careers, offering a wide variety of courses in science, mathematics, humanities, arts, and world languages.
Beyond academics, Ben Lippen promotes participation in athletics, performing arts, and extracurricular clubs, allowing students to explore their talents and develop interpersonal skills. Faculty members are dedicated to mentorship, fostering relationships with students to guide both academic progress and personal growth. The school also emphasizes global awareness, cultural understanding, and community engagement, preparing students to navigate an increasingly complex and interconnected world. By combining rigorous academic programs with spiritual guidance, Ben Lippen equips students to excel in higher education and become responsible, compassionate, and informed global citizens.

School Facts
| Category | Details |
|---|---|
| Founding Year | 1940 |
| Motto | “Faith, Knowledge, Service” |
| School Type | Private, Christian, College-Preparatory |
| Grade Levels | PK–12 |
| Mascot | Eagle |
| School Colors | Blue and Gold |

Ben Lippen School Application Requirements
Applicants are required to submit academic transcripts, standardized test scores, and completed application forms. Recommendations from teachers and school leaders are requested to provide insight into character, work ethic, and engagement. Additionally, applicants may be asked to provide a personal essay or statement reflecting their interests, values, and alignment with the school’s Christian mission. Admissions interviews are conducted to assess the student’s interpersonal skills, maturity, and readiness to contribute positively to the Ben Lippen community. This comprehensive approach ensures that students admitted to Ben Lippen are not only academically capable but also aligned with the school’s emphasis on faith, service, and personal growth.

Ben Lippen School Tuition Fee (Costs)
| Category | Cost |
|---|---|
| Annual Tuition | $17,000–$20,000 |
| Activity Fees | $200–$500 |
| Technology Fee | $150 |
| Athletics/Arts Fee | Varies by Participation |
